Through the ninth century, the town of Shiraz experienced already recognized a standing for creating the best wine on the planet,[one] and was Iran's wine money. The export of Shiraz wine by European merchants during the 17th century has been documented. As explained by enthusiastic English and French travellers on the area from the seventeenth to nineteenth hundreds of years, the wine developed near town was of a more dilute character as a consequence of irrigation, while the most beneficial Shiraz wines have been essentially developed in terraced vineyards throughout the village of Khollar.

Smaller quantities of Syrah also are Employed in the manufacture of other wine kinds, which include rosé wine, fortified wine in Port wine model, and sparkling purple wine.[twenty] Although Australian glowing Shiraz customarily have had some sweetness, visit the website a variety of Australian winemakers also make a total-bodied glowing dry Shiraz, which consists of the complexity and in some cases earthy notes that are Typically present in continue to wine.[21]

The Syrah grape was introduced into Australia in 1832 by James Busby, an immigrant who brought vine clippings from Europe with him, and it is nearly invariably termed "Shiraz".[6] Right now it's Australia's most popular crimson grape, but has not generally been in this kind of favour; inside the nineteen seventies, white wine was so popular that growers ended up ripping out unprofitable Shiraz and Grenache vineyards, even All those with old vines.
